The overall purpose and objective of this position is to contribute to the work of the company’s legal department in a broad range of day-to-day legal work.

This role requires a high level of organizational skill, attention to detail, and the ability to handle multiple tasks and coordinate with various departments and external entities under the supervision of the General Counsel or the Manager of the Legal Department. The main responsibilities include the following:

  1. Assistance to the General Counsel (follow up on department progress and objective achievement, assistance with meetings preparation, assist with cases and projects planning, help to prepare key presentations)
  2. Secretarial and administrative work for the Legal Department (correspondence, filing, meeting arrangements, travel arrangements)
  3. Administrative litigations follow up (budget, status of the case, invoices, follow up with lawyer, circularization with auditors)
  4. Organizing and archiving the documents related to completed and ongoing cases
  5. Update and maintain contract templates, Data Room for key legal documentation, maintain Contract Data Base, legal document securing
  6. Drafts and analyses of simple legal documents (NDA, dismissal letters, answers to day-to-day simple legal questions, etc.)
  7. Ad hoc legal queries from the legal team to conduct legal research (case law, bibliography, academic materials), or retrieve internal information needed for legal case management
  8. Help in the development of Legal Training materials (mainly for internal functions), arrange for training sessions
  9. Structure and preserve internal legal knowledge built over cases
  10. Monitoring and update on jurisprudence developments
  11. Stations administration (Network/Set-up or closing/Legal representative-lawyers, PoA, mandates, Legalizations, Apostilles)
  12. Follow up/signature of legal documents

Essential Requirements For The Position:

  1. Bachelor’s degree in the legal field
  2. Previous experience either in a law firm or the legal department of a company
  3. Basic legal knowledge in civil law, commercial law, corporate law, and social law
  4. Proven experience as an administrative assistant
  5. Ability to work with a high degree of autonomy
  6. Excellent attention to detail, time management skills, and ability to prioritize work
  7. Ability to successfully communicate with all levels of management, stakeholders, vendors, and customers
  8. Ability to prioritize multiple tasks with competing deadlines
  9. Highly developed written and oral communication skills, with emphasis on negotiating and drafting commercial agreements and attention to detail
  10. Fluency in written and spoken English; other languages are considered a plus
  11. Advanced knowledge of MS Office (Word, Excel, PowerPoint, and Outlook)

Working Conditions:

  1. A Certificate of good conduct (Casier judiciaire, Polizeiliches Führungszeugnis) will be required in case of positive selection
  2. Full-time, permanent position based in Luxembourg
  3. The internal title and contract for this role will be ‚Officer Legal Affairs.‘
